【问题标题】:Don't show video viewer UIImagePickerController不显示视频查看器 UIImagePickerController
【发布时间】:2016-11-02 09:37:58
【问题描述】:

我正在使用以下代码启动照片库:

if UIImagePickerController.isSourceTypeAvailable(.photoLibrary) {
        let imagePicker = UIImagePickerController()
        imagePicker.delegate = self
        imagePicker.sourceType = .photoLibrary
        imagePicker.mediaTypes = [kUTTypeMovie as String, kUTTypeImage as String]
        imagePicker.allowsEditing = false
        self.present(imagePicker, animated: true, completion: nil)
    }

从我的照片库中选择一个视频后,而不是调用 imagePickerController(_:didFinishPickingMediaWithInfo:) 函数,它转到一个视图,允许我在顶部使用视频清理器播放视频。然后我按选择它调用该函数。如何跳过显示允许我播放视频的视图?

【问题讨论】:

    标签: ios swift


    【解决方案1】:

    我相信在使用.photoLibrary 作为源类型时,不可能跳过那部分。

    您可以在将源类型设置为 camera 并编写以下内容时跳过:

    imagePicker.showsCameraControls = false
    

    查看Link了解更多详情

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 2012-05-22
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2011-12-14
      相关资源
      最近更新 更多